If managers come to developers with problems that are NP complete, no matter how well they transfer the idea/vision, or set time expectations, the problem cannot be solved efficiently. And, unless the developers have been trained in CS/Math they may not even understand that what they are being asked to do cannot be done.
For example, say a manager has an idea to find the largest group of friends in a massive social network. He wants a developer to write an app for that and has a 20K budget and 2 months. You could not write this app with 10 times that budget or time.
How can you determine which group of friends is the largest?

I think the point is that relying on phone calls and DTMF tones for two factor authentication is trivial to bypass. Anyone can record DTMF tones in a voicemail message and forward calls to that number.
